Why Gym Motivation Matters
It’s the motivation that’ll get you to the gym, it’s discipline that will keep you in the gym! Here’s some research in the area of sports psychology, that offers pointers to maintain that discipline –positive self talk, visualization, habit building and creating reasonable goals. Gym lovers lean on the power of habit rather than the ever shifting force of motivation.
Benefits include:
- Better workout consistency
- Increased confidence
- Reduced excuses
- Stronger mental resilience
- Improved long-term fitness habits

Comparison: Motivation vs Discipline
| Motivation | Discipline |
| Emotional | Habit-based |
| Temporary | Long-lasting |
| Changes daily | Consistent |
| Starts action | Sustains action |
| Depends on mood | Depends on routine |
| Easy to lose | Stronger over time |
Key Takeaway: Build systems rather than waiting to feel motivated.
How to Stay Motivated Beyond Quotes
Quotes work best when combined with practical habits.
Try these proven strategies:
- Set realistic fitness goals.
- Track workouts weekly.
- Celebrate small milestones.
- Follow a structured workout plan.
- Train with a friend.
- Use a fitness tracking app.
- Take monthly progress photos.
- Focus on long-term health instead of quick results.

Troubleshooting Low Motivation
| Problem | Solution |
| Skipping workouts | Schedule fixed gym times |
| Feeling tired | Prioritize sleep and nutrition |
| Plateau | Change workout routine |
| Boredom | Try new exercises |
| No visible progress | Track strength improvements instead of weight |
